GABRIELLE KORN is a writer, editor, and strategist. Most recently, she ran LGBTQ strategy at Netflix. Prior to that, she worked in editorial, holding leadership roles including Editor-in-Chief of Nylon Media and Director of Fashion & Culture at Refinery29. She is the author of Everybody (Else) Is Perfect, and her writing has been published across the internet since 2011, with bylines in Instyle, Coveteur, Autostraddle, Nylon, Refinery29, Oprah, and more.
She lives in Los Angeles with her wife.
